Deusdedit Kakoko, the ejected Director-General of Tanzania Ports Authority (TPA), has been apprehended a day after he was suspended over fraud allegations.

Media reports indicate Kakoko was taken into custody for grilling on Monday night following a raid at his home by detectives from the Prevention and Combating of Corruption Bureau (PCCB).

During the operation, the officials seized $1.5 billion (Ksh164 million) at his home. The money was stuck in a small bag.

The raid comes amid reports that billions of shillings were recently withdrawn from the Central Bank of Tanzania on orders from the fired TPA boss after the death of President John Pombe Magufuli.

The money is said to have been transferred to a personal account at National Microfinance Bank (NMB).

The money which included $11,799,357.91 and TSh6.3 billion, was transferred to NMB four days after the death of Magufuli which according to authorities occurred on March 17.
